CHRISTMAS IN THE PATCH
It was a beautiful night on
the Winter Elder stage for
Deana Covin’s production of
‘A Celebration of Stars’
Thursday night. A performance
by KC’s band, twirlers
and Rangerettes got the
show started, then it was
time to throw the switch to
light up the stars, (top left
photo) as the Rangerette
Officers threw the switch,
Capt. Dru Dawkins, Lt. Erica
Stine, Lt. Rachel Lunsford, Lt.
Claire Cumble and Lt. Nicole
Ahlfinger. (photos top right
clockwise) Mark Fried sang
with the Sabine Singing
Sensations, the Kilgore
Quartet sang, the KC drumline
performed, Brian Bittick
sang Silent Night, Mallory
Burgess sang “I Saw Mommy
Kissing Santa Claus”, the
Tambourines shook to the
music, Allyson Honeycutt,
along with other members
of the Kilgore High School
Hi-Steppers danced to
“White Christmas”, John
Whitehead and Debbie
Dane sang “Up on the Derricks”
and Hannah Reynolds
sang “Santa Claus is Coming
to Town”, accompanied by
her dad, Lucas Reynolds.
